A team of seven people answered the call of a Northland Church to provide them with a Ministry team for their Church Camp.
The Ministry Team had the backing of our home Church with prayer, fasting and equipment. The whole team had been asked to pray and fast for this upcoming weekend and the hosting Church were doing the same.
The preparation prior to the Weekend was extensive. Constant prayer by Sandra undergirded the weekend from conception to completion. The Leader (Jim) felt God had given him 3 topics to talk on but he struggled for the 4th. One of the team members (Charlotte) who had never preached before really felt God telling her that she was to do a session and what she was to talk about. With absolute trepidation she plucked up the courage and made the suggestion. This was readily accepted by Jim and thus the topics of the weekend were God’s ordained.
The technical part of the team (Chris and Trevor) worked extremely hard getting everything on computers and letting the hosting church know our requirements. The music couple (Allan and Lorraine) worked long hours on the song selection and preparation.
Things didn’t go very smoothly with many obstacles in the way but all felt that with God in this it would sort itself out and it eventually did. Even a car laden down with all the gear wouldn’t start after lunch on the trip up North because of a flat battery (headlights accidently left on) and a GPS took another car load of people and equipment to a footbridge instead of the camp but we all arrived in time with everything intact.
The sleeping and preparation areas for the Team were a test of endurance and grace. The sound equipment provided was certainly not up to expectations but God sure was. To watch the hosting church blossom over the weekend was a miracle. The Team needing to rely on God and each other to bring about what proved to be an amazing celebration. Team members quietly moving around the rooms or outside as they sensed God’s prompting and always praying was such a huge comfort to those up front at that particular time.
We saw many people released from bondage and weariness. Many were renewed.
After the evening session it was the young people's turn (teenagers). We started at 11pm with loud music and singing, some prayer then we moved into a time of questions. They were given permission to ask us anything on any subject imaginable. The questions came thick and fast and were more often than not ones the young people really couldn’t ask their parents. This was quite a test for many of the Ministry Team but answers were given to all questions. We believe that these young people really appreciated us being open and honest with them.
The next day (or should I say only a few hours later) some of us went down to the little beach at the camp and sat on the shore only to discover at breakfast time that there was a tsunami warning for New Zealand. Fortunately we didn’t experience anything out of the ordinary.
In the first session on Sunday, many of the youth were able to declare that they were “in God’s army” and were determined to move forward. What an amazing blessing to us all that was.
The drive home after such a great weekend was filled with laughter, jokes and excited talk. Texts flew between the two cars keeping us all in communication with each other and keeping us from feeling the effects of sleep depravation. To know that our home Church of All Saints were praying for us not only individually but within their services was reassuring.
The team worked together seamlessly and with joy and would willingly do it all again if we felt it was God’s call. What a great time we all had. What a blessing we all received.
Praise God for his provision in everything we do when it is His will.
